2009.07.8 Ebay
warwick, NY, United States
RARE NAVY BLUE CAMARO WITH LS1 CORVETTE MOTOR AND A T-56 6 SPEED TRANSMISSION WITH UNDER 92,000 MILES. CAR IS CLEAN, MINOR SCRATCHES HERE AND THERE AND A SMALL DING IN DRIVERS REAR QUARTER THAT YOU CAN BARELY SEE. PAINT IS NICE. INTERIOR IS TWO TONE. TAN CARPET AND LOWER PANELS, DARK GREY LEATHER SEATS, UPPER PLASTICS AND DASH. SMALL PIECE MISSING OUT OF DRIVER SEAT BOTTOM CORNER OTHERWISE THE LEATHER IS IN GREAT CONDITION, ESPECIALLY FOR A 10 YEAR OLD CAR. SUSPENSION HAS BEEN UPGRADED. TOKICO REAR STRUTS, ADJUSTABLE TORQUE ARM, LOWER CONTROL ARMS, AND PANHARD BAR. EXHAUST UPGRADED ALSO, LONG TUBES AND OR Y PIPE TO A BORLA CATBACK WITH BAFFLE ADJUSTMENTS. HAVE IT BLOCKED OFF AT THE MOMENT TO KEEP NOISE DOWN. OTHER MODS INCLUDE FULL VALVE TRANE UPGRADES, HARDENED PUSHRODS, DUAL VALVE SPRINGS, HEAVY DUTY CAM CHAIN. YOU COULD PUT A BIG CAM IN THIS CAR WITH THESE SUPPORTING PARTS. CAR ALSO HAS PORTED POLISHED 5.3 HEADS, ARP HEAD STUDS, PORTED LS6 OIL PUMP, AND THROTTLE BODY, NEW SLOTTED ROTORS AND NEW BRAKES ALL THE WAY AROUND, AND PLENTY OF RUBBER ON THE TIRES. CAR HAS A FRESH TUNE IN IT BY SICK SPEED PERFORMANCE AND PUT DOWN 324 HP, 321 TQ ON MUSTANG DYNO. REAR END HAS 410 GEARS IN IT WITH A TA GIRDLE. IT WHINES A BIT, BUT IS SOLID |
